Curt Olson will demonstrate color pencil techniques at the Monroe Art League meeting on Oct. 28 at 6:30 p.m.
Olson, an accomplished artist, has a background in education and art, according to a community announcement. He earned his bachelor's in fine arts and master's in education from Eastern Michigan University.
Olson taught art for more than 32 years in Royal Oak and Summerfield schools, working with students from kindergarten through 12th grade. He has been a member of the Bedford Artist Club for many years and joined the Toledo Potters Guild after retiring from teaching. Recently, Olson donated more than 20 bowls to the Empty Bowl Dinner fundraiser.
